Story
Plumette (plume) is a very sweet and timid kitty. We adopted her 1.5 years ago and it took about 3 months for her to warm up to us to the point where she would come up and ask for pets and cuddles, but still did not like to be pet unless she requested it and would run away. We moved about a year ago, and then had a baby aboout 4 months ago and has not seemed very happy since those transitions. She has 2 other siblings, which she gets along with but never really cuddles or plays with them, she is very submissive so I believe she would do well in a household with other cats, but is not necessary as she usually plays by herself. I believe she would do well in a low energy, no kid household. She is a very sweet kitty and I would love to find a family that has time to grow a connection with her in a less stressful environment.
